    Gray Box Testing, which is also known as translucent testing, acts as a bridge between the black-box and white-box testing. It is an important test that provides a powerful approach to test the software product externally based on its internal working.

    Build Verification Test (BVT) is a set of tests that is executed on every new software build to assess and verify its readiness to face off & undergo through more thorough & rigorous testing procedures. Few of its important features are: Executed on every new build. Test cases are of shorter duration Automation is preferred to execute BVT cases
